Shawn ‘Clown’ Crahan, the creative force behind Slipknot, has taken a bold step into the digital realm with the launch of his unique Minecraft world, Vernearth. This new venture is not just another gaming server; it is a meticulously crafted universe that boasts an evolving narrative and a variety of engaging game modes.
Exploring Vernearth
Described as a “surreal landscape built from over 100 million blocks,” Vernearth invites players to explore its dynamic terrain, which is inhabited by enigmatic guardians known as Mind Stewards. The world is designed to be rich with hidden paths and secrets waiting to be uncovered, offering an immersive experience that transcends traditional gameplay.
The development of Vernearth has utilized “custom technology” alongside handcrafted environments, ensuring a unique experience for players. Four distinct game modes await adventurers:
- Oblivion: A vast, custom-generated survival world that merges realism with elements inspired by Clown’s artistic vision.
- The Arena: A high-octane multiplayer fighting space designed for intense competition.
- Plotworld: A collaborative creative haven where players can build freely, merge plots, and engage in social activities, including monthly build contests.
- Challenge Mode: A seasonal hardcore game that resets every 45 days, featuring a new Slipknot theme to keep the excitement alive.
According to a press release, Vernearth aims to cater to a diverse audience, from explorers and builders to streamers and competitive players, promising something innovative for everyone.
Reflecting on the potential of technology, Clown remarked, “We’re in an era where technology means absolutely anything is possible. With the metaverse, I can come up with any concept and utilize it perfectly in a digital world.” He emphasized the importance of embracing change, stating, “Don’t be scared of this new technology. You have to go with change. Otherwise, you get left behind, and I don’t want that for our family.”
